I have a 2-disc DVD called Rumours: Behind the Scenes which includes:

-the Rosebud documentary
-tons of backstage footage from Budokan 1977 (including Stevie doing her hair and putting on makeup)
-the plane scene where Stevie acts like a flight attendant/tells Lindsey that he isn't in first class or whatever
-a few songs from Budokan 1977 (Over My Head, YMLF, four versions of Rhiannon, Oh Daddy)
-then randomly at the end of the second disc there's Silver Springs from Germany 1998 lol
